Description

Matched pair of early 20th Century hand carved English carousel fairground columns

A rare and highly decorative pair of early 20th-century fairground ride columns carved from timber and retaining their wonderfully evocative original painted finish, marked number 5 and 10 on the reverse.

Each column is surmounted by an intricately detailed capital and finished to the front with a hand-painted insignia. Rich faux-marbling, polychrome decoration, metallic accents and classical architectural motifs give the pair the theatrical presence so characteristic of the golden age of the British fairground.

These columns would originally have formed part of a larger decorative scheme, accompanied by a number of similar examples adorning the façade or structure of a fairground ride. Their craftsmanship and distinctive decorative language are closely associated with the work of celebrated fairground manufacturers such as Orton & Spooner, who were active during the early decades of the 20th century.

Based in Burton-on-Trent, Staffordshire, Orton & Spooner were among Britain's most important and influential manufacturers and decorators of fairground rides, living wagons and elaborate show fronts. Rather than travelling showmen themselves, they were the craftsmen responsible for creating many of the spectacular rides and richly ornamented environments that came to define the British travelling fairground from the late Victorian period into the mid-20th century.

These two surviving columns beautifully embody the aesthetic of that tradition. Their faux-marbled paintwork, flashes of metallic colour and Egyptian Revival and winged classical motifs were conceived not merely as decoration, but as spectacle—designed to catch the eye and shimmer brilliantly beneath the lights of a bustling fairground.

Today, they stand as wonderfully sculptural pieces of British folk and fairground art, retaining the colour, character and theatrical exuberance of the era from which they came.

Condition Report

Both examples are solid in structure and form and present very well. They display age-related wear across the surfaces, with areas of rust to the metal brackets, as shown. One pillar exhibits greater wear to the central section than the other, with some loss to the painted detail.

Importantly, both retain their original first paint, making them somewhat rarer than the overpainted examples more commonly encountered. There is also some light loss to the timber on one of the capitals, as shown.

Carousel columns were functional and decorative structural components used on late 19th and early 20th-century travelling fairground rides. They supported the canopy framework while displaying vibrant paintwork and carved motifs designed to attract visitors under theatrical lighting.

Fairground pillars were predominantly crafted from lightweight yet durable woods such as pine or lime. They were finished with multiple coats of oil-based paint, gilding, and decorative scagliola or hand-painted faux-marbling techniques to emulate expensive stone.

Authentic pieces usually show distinct signs of wear from repeated assembly and transport, including bolt holes, iron mounting brackets, and layered repaint history. Original hand-carved detailing and hand-painted faux finishes are key indicators of period craftsmanship.

Architectural columns can be styled as standalone sculptural objects in room corners, placed symmetrically to frame an entrance or alcove, or used to elevate decorative urns and busts within an eclectic interior scheme.

Clean gently using a soft, dry microfibre cloth to remove dust without abrading the historic surface paint. Keep timber away from direct heat sources and high humidity to prevent wood shrinkage, cracking, or flaking paint layer separation.
